description abstractEffective management of construction projects depends on good access to and control of data, especially data pertaining to cost‐ and schedule‐control functions. Long recognizing the need to integrate these interrelated functions and to improve the quality, integrity, and timeliness of data, researchers have proposed conceptual models to achieve this purpose. However, the proper design and development of an automated solution that would support the needs of integrated cost and schedule control and acquire and store quality data in a timely manner has been lacking. Aware of these deficiencies, we designed and developed a successful prototype of an automated cost‐ and schedule‐control system that is based on the work‐packaging model and that uses bar coding in its data‐acquisition component. The purpose of this paper, then, is to discuss the prototype's capabilities and components and to illustrate how the system is used in controlling cost and schedule of a study case based on an actual construction project.
